For several weeks now, I have been doing some serious housekeeping. Too early for spring cleaning you say but no, I am doing some housekeeping on my 500GB external hard drive which is in danger of running out of space really soon.

Not too long ago, having a 500GB hard drive was like moving into a 2000 sq ft. home from a 500 sq. ft. apartment. There's so much room in the house that you start acquiring things with reckless abandon without regard for where you're actually gonna store them due to the seemingly unlimite space. A few years later, your car is parked by the street because even your garage is filled to the brim. Housekeeping and a garage sale is then in the offing. And that's where I'm at right now - getting rid of files to free up space in my 2000 sq ft home I call a hard drive.
